If you are planning so you’re able to celebrate Romantic days celebration with a new companion, there is a good chance you met on line, which surveys recommend is quick becoming the most common method some body meet up. Obviously, looking through character immediately following profile brings in it many different dilemmas.

Perhaps the truth is, studies have shown this one ones problems is simply trying do not be dependent on the order in which you look at those individuals users.

“Sequential outcomes” (otherwise “serial reliance”) is a kind of prejudice understood in the area of mindset. Scientists are finding that the earlier goods into the a series affects how you court the present day item, whether or not this involves grading Olympic activities otherwise students’ essays.

We including know that people’s judgements from facial appeal tell you that it prejudice. The latest advice of your impression can go in one of one or two suggests – the fresh new beauty of the modern face are either taken to the the opinion of the prior you to (assimilation) otherwise forced away from it (contrast).

This might count on how comparable we believe the 2 confronts are located in other points particularly gender or ethnicity. Higher resemblance ranging from face does trigger a whole lot more intake. Lowest resemblance produces faster absorption, otherwise may even bring about contrast.

For-instance, in the event the history images you saw try extremely glamorous plus the you to definitely you happen to be already given shares numerous has actually in accordance (eg, both are southern Asian feminine that have a lot of time, dark hair) then you are prone to rate this due to the fact attractive too.

These biases as well as apply at other feature judgements including honesty, intelligence and you can prominence. So in the sense which our views about attractiveness are dependent on the earlier deal with we saw, decisions about numerous most other services are too.

To complicate things, it isn’t obvious whether this type of sequential consequences are caused by a perceptual bias (what we should concept of the last face you will transform how exactly we see the latest one) or a reply bias (the way we in person responded to the earlier deal with you’ll affect all of our second reaction) just like the scientists generally query people in order to speed all the face into the investigation.

However, one to United kingdom study from 2021 made an effort to independent away these explanations by inquiring people to gain access to (although not respond to) the previous deal with before get the modern that. The outcome shown a comparison impression, where decisions of one’s newest face managed to move on from the attractiveness of the deal with seen earlier (supplied by an alternative group of professionals). Therefore, the brand new assistance out of bias might rely on if or not our company is just enjoying faces otherwise having to definitely court all of them.

Needless to say, appeal judgements will make the types of a binary decision (“hot or perhaps not”) when enjoying relationship users, just like the kept otherwise proper swipe utilized by networks instance since Tinder. Experts have also discover sequential consequences with this particular version of judgement.

Professionals inside the an excellent 2016 study viewed a sequence out-of face and you can decided if for each and every try “attractive” or “unattractive”. The results displayed an assimilation feeling – participants was in fact more likely to speed a face once the glamorous when they think the brand new preceding face try glamorous than just if it try unattractive.

While research has shown one to photos have fun with the greatest part in the an online dating profile’s total attractiveness, other factors such as vocabulary problems regarding text message can dictate all of our judgements. Interestingly, in one single research in which images and you may text message on the same dating reputation have been rated from the different people, there’s a relationship involving the rated elegance supplied to the new photos while the (alone rated) text message one then followed them.

Since feedback out of observed rely on were along with gathered, the fresh scientists were able to demonstrate that myself attractive somebody tended to write associated text and this fulfilled as more confident, with this specific text evaluated to get more desirable from the anyone else.

Exactly what do i take away out of a few of these degree? You may already know regarding the a good amount of biases that folks show whenever perceiving the nation. Such as, everyone is at the mercy of recognizing faces inside inanimate stuff or more browsing attribute positive qualities so you can attractive people.

But not, you do not was conscious watching sequences regarding things can transform their judgements. That’s not to declare that going for your lover are totally because of the quality of the latest profile one to happened in order to pop up before theirs, nonetheless it may have played a job.
